Understanding Sterling Silver
What is Sterling Silver?
Sterling silver is an alloy consisting of 92.5% pure silver and 7.5% of other metals, usually copper. This blend enhances the durability and strength of the metal while maintaining its beautiful luster. The purity of sterling silver is commonly denoted by the stamp “925”, signifying its quality.
The Appeal of Sterling Silver
Sterling silver is beloved for its bright, shiny finish and versatility. It can easily complement various gemstones and styles, making it a popular choice for all types of jewellery, including wedding rings. Its affordability compared to gold and platinum also makes it an attractive option for couples on a budget.

Cons of Choosing Sterling Silver for Wedding Rings
- Durability: Sterling silver is softer than other metals and prone to scratches and dents. If you lead an active lifestyle or work with your hands, this might be a concern.
- Tarnishing: Over time, sterling silver can tarnish due to exposure to moisture and air. Regular cleaning and maintenance are required to keep it looking its best.
- Long-Term Value: While sterling silver can be beautiful, it does not hold its value in the same way as gold or platinum, which may be a consideration for some couples.
Evaluating Durability
How Does Sterling Silver Compare to Other Metals?
When considering wedding rings, durability is a critical factor. While sterling silver is a lovely choice, it may not stand the test of time as well as other metals. For example:
- Gold: Both 14k and 18k gold are more durable than sterling silver, making them better suited for everyday wear. Gold wedding rings can withstand the rigors of daily life without losing their shape or finish.
- Platinum: Known for its strength and hypoallergenic properties, platinum is an excellent choice for those with sensitive skin. Platinum wedding rings can endure wear and tear far better than sterling silver.

Exploring Alternatives to Sterling Silver
While sterling silver has its merits, you may also want to explore alternative metals for your wedding rings. Here are a few popular options:
White Gold
- Composition: White gold is an alloy of yellow gold mixed with metals like palladium or nickel, enhancing its durability and giving it a beautiful white finish.
- Advantages: It is more resistant to scratching and tarnishing than sterling silver, making it suitable for everyday wear.
- Considerations: Some white gold alloys may contain nickel, which can cause allergic reactions in sensitive individuals. Opting for nickel-free alloys or palladium white gold can mitigate this issue.
Yellow Gold
- Aesthetic Appeal: Yellow gold has a classic and timeless appeal, often symbolizing wealth and luxury.
- Durability: 14k and 18k yellow gold are more durable than sterling silver, making them a better long-term investment for wedding rings.
Platinum
- Longevity: Platinum is the most durable and hypoallergenic metal, making it ideal for everyday wear. It doesn’t wear away over time, maintaining its weight and integrity.
- Investment: While pricier than sterling silver, platinum often holds its value better, making it a wise investment for wedding rings.

Caring for Your Sterling Silver Wedding Ring
If you decide to go with a sterling silver wedding ring, proper care will help maintain its beauty and longevity:
- Regular Cleaning: Clean your ring with a silver polishing cloth regularly to remove tarnish and maintain its shine.
- Storage: Keep your sterling silver jewellery in a cool, dry place, ideally in a jewelry box lined with anti-tarnish material.
- Avoiding Chemicals: Limit exposure to harsh chemicals, such as cleaning agents or chlorinated water, which can accelerate tarnishing.
